Giuseppe DiMenza was wearing a black sweater and heavy jacket when he drove off from his home in a white, four-door 2003 Audi A4 a day earlier, concerned family members said just hours before getting word that he'd been found at a service station.
"He didn't say where he was going and doesn't have a cell phone," his granddaughter, Natasha Rose said earlier. "He speaks Italian and very little English. He hasn't been feeling well, and we are worried about him."
